1.Research progress in the relationship between adipokines and breast cancer
Cancer Research and Clinic 2013;(3):208-210
Research on the relationship between obesity and breast cancer has been deepened in recent years.Obese breast cancer patients have poorer prognosis than normal-weight patients.Weight variation is correlated with relapse in breast cancer survivors.The role of adipokines in this process can not be ignored.The correlations between adipokines,estrogen,cell proliferation,angiogenesis and breast cancer prognosis are reviewed in this article.
2.The risk and anesthetic management of scar uterus undergoing cesarean section
The Journal of Clinical Anesthesiology 2009;25(12):1020-1022
Objective To investigate the risks and anesthetic management of scar uterus undergoing cesarean section.MethodsOne hundred pregnant women(aged 24-43 years old)with scar uterus underwent cesarean section.Epidural anesthesia was used in 90 cases(group A)and general anesthesia in 10 cases(group B).The monitorings included ECG,BP,HR and SpO_2.CVP was measured in the high risk cases.The time from skin incision tO neonatal delivery(I-D).the time from uterine incision to delivery(U-D),and Apgar scores of neonates were recorded.Results Incomplete blockade was seen in 20 cases(22%).The I-D time was shorter in group B than that in group A[(7.5±2.0)min vs.(12.3±2.6)min](P<0.01).Intraoperative hypotension occurred in 32 cases (32%).Neonatal asphyxia happened in 21 cases(21%).Apgar scores of 11 neonatals werc less than 3,of whom 5 neonates died.Apgar scores were 4 to 7 in 10 cases,8 to 10 in 79 cases.Subtotal uterectomy was performed in 2 cases.Repair of injuried bladder had to be done in one case.Intraoperative huge bleeding took place in 15 cases.Conclusion The scar uterus undergoing cesarean section has a high risk for mothers and neonates.The incidence of incomplete epidural blockade is higher.Effectively preventing and managing the risk factors are the keys for reducing maternal and neonatal complications and mortality.

4.Advances in arrested late lung development and bronchopulmonary dysplasia
International Journal of Pediatrics 2015;42(6):615-618
The process of late lung development is disturbed in bronchopulmonary dysplasia (BPD).One of the keys in late lung development is secondary septation, in which secondary septa arise from primary septa, producing plenty of small alveoli, which significantly increase the surface area of gas exchange.Secondary septation,together with architectural changes to the vascular structure of the lung which minimize the distance between the blood and the inspired air, are the targets of late lung development.BPD is a disease of premature infants in which development of the alveoli is stunted caused by many factors including volutrauma,inflammation,and oxygen toxicity.Compared with early lung development, the later development of the immature lung remains unclear.This paper is to emphasize remarkable latest research of arrested late lung development and BPD.
5.Clinical effect of escitalopram oxalate in treating patients with depression accompanied with anxiety disorder
Chinese Journal of Primary Medicine and Pharmacy 2016;(4):598-602
Objective To study the clinical effect of escitalopram oxalate in treating patients with depression accompanied with anxiety disorder.Methods Sixty-four patients with depression accompanied with anxiety disorder (met DSM-IV diagnostic criteria)were randomly divided into study group (n =32)who were treated with escitalo-pram oxalate 5-20mg/d and control group (n =32)with mirtazapine 15-45 for eight weeks.Clinical effect was evalua-ted with the Hamilton Depression Scale (HAMD)and the Hamilton Anxiety Scale (HAMA)as well as the adverse reactions with the Treatment Emergent Symptom Scale (TESS).Results There were no statistically significant differ-ences (P >0.05)in HAMD and HAMA scores between the study group and control group before treatment,but after treatment for 8 weeks,HAMD score showed statistically significant difference (P =0.000)and the difference of HAMA score was statistically significant (P =0.010).The total effective rate of the study group was 93.8%,which of the control group was 87.5%,the clinical effect had no statistically significant difference (P =0.391 ).The study group and the control group had equal effect,and there were no serious adverse reactions.Conclusion Escitalopram oxalate has high anti-depressant and anxiolytic effect,fewer adverse reactions,good tolerability and compliance,there-fore,escitalopram oxalate can be popularized in treating patients with depression accompanied with anxiety disorder.

7.Progress of bispecific antibodies targeting immune checkpoints in treatment of tumors
Xiaoqing CHEN ; Fentian CHEN ; Wenxin LUO
Cancer Research and Clinic 2021;33(3):221-225
Immune checkpoint is one of the most effective research targets for tumor immunotherapy. Immune checkpoint inhibitors, mainly programmed death receptor 1 and its ligand 1, have achieved good response rates in various tumor treatments, but some tumors still have low response rates. In recent years, bispecific antibodies have developed rapidly in the field of tumor research, because they can target multiple targets and play a combined role in tumor therapy, and can effectively inhibit tumor immune escape. This article reviews the research progress and clinical status of bispecific antibodies targeting immune checkpoints.
9.Microbial contamination in dental unit waterlines A comparison among different specialty departments in a stomatological hospital
Pingping XU ; Xiaochun CHEN ; Xiaoqing SHEN
Chinese Journal of Tissue Engineering Research 2009;13(51):10189-10192
BACKGROUND: The presence of various microorganisms in dental unit waterlines has been revealed by numerous reports previously. However, impact of different dental procedures on microbial contamination in dental unit waterlines (DUWLs) remains unclearly.OBJECTIVE: To assess the level of microbial contamination in water effluent from the high-speed handpiece line of dental chair units (DCUs) among different specialty departments in a provincial stomatological hospital. Thus, to propose individual infection control measures for different specialty departments according to their properties of microbial contamination.DESIGN, TIME AND SETTING: A cross-sectional investigation was designed and conducted in Guangdong Provincial Stomatological Hospital and Laboratory of Microbiology, School of Public Health and Tropical Medicine, Southern Medical University, between May 2007 and March 2008.MATERIALS: The materials used in this investigation including nutrient agar, blood plates, biochemical testing kit, agglutination testing kit and Gram staining agents. These materials were purchased from Guangdong Huankai Microbial Science and Technology Co., Ltd.METHODS: Water sampling was conducted at 80 DCUs of different specialty departments in Guangdong Provincial Stomatological Hospital. A total of 60 mL, with 6 mL for once sampling of water effluent from the high-speed handpiece line of each DCU were collected aseptically after the finish of the daily clinical work on every second Friday between May and October in 2007. Standard isolation and identification technique of bacteria was adopted.MAIN OUTCOME MEASURES: Concentration of bacteria and prevalence of 3 species of bacteria in water effluent from the high-speed handpiece line of DCUs among different specialty departments were evaluated.RESULTS: Concentration of bacteria in water effluent from the high-speed handpiece line of DCUs averaged 5.67×10~2 cfu/mL, ranged from 5.15×10 to 1.59×10~3 cfu/mL. The microbial concentration of water samples from Department of Periodontics was significantly higher than that from other departments, while the microbial concentration of water samples from Department of Oral Surgery was the lowest (P = 0.000).CONCLUSION: Contamination in water effluent from the high-speed handpiece line of DCUs varied from different specialty departments in the provincial stomatological hospital. It is suggested that DUWLs flushing should be performed routinely, especially for the department without frequent use of the high-speed handpiece in the daily work, and extra infection control measures should be adopted for the department with severe clinical operative contamination.
10.Microbial contamination in dental unit waterlines with different flushing volume
Pingping XU ; Xiaochun CHEN ; Xiaoqing SHEN
Chinese Journal of Tissue Engineering Research 2009;13(52):10397-10400
BACKGROUND:Daily flushing of dental unit waterlines (DUWLs) is believed to be the least expensive and simplest method for reducing the level of microbial contamination in DUWLs.Authorities' guidelines suggest that high-speed handpieces should be run to discharge water for 30 seconds after use on each patient.However,the guideline is inaccurate for clinicians according to the time-dependent flushing since the maximum flow rate of flushing water varied from dental chair units (DCUs).OBJECTIVE:To assess the level of microbial contamination in water effluent from the air-water syringe and the high-speed handpiece line of DCUs and prevalence of three species of bacteria detected in DUWLs at each flushing volume.Thus,practical water flushing measures could be proposed according to the effect of volume-dependent dental unit waterline flushing on the microbial contamination in DUWLs.DESIGN,TIME AND SETTING:A cross-sectional investigation was designed and conducted in Guangdong Provincial Stomatological Hospital and Laboratory of Microbiology,School of Public Health and Tropical Medicine,Southern Medical University between May 2007 and March 2008.MATERIALS:The materials used in this investigation including nutrient agar,blood plates,biochemical testing kit,agglutination testing kit and Gram staining agents.These materials were supported by Guangdong Huankai Microbiological Science and Technology Ltd.METHODS:Water sampling was conducted at 80 DCUs in a stomatologicel hospital.A total of 6 mL,2 mL for once sampling,of continuous water flushing from the air-water syringe and the high-speed handpiece line of each DCU respectively were collected aseptically after the finish of the daily clinical work on every second Friday,between May 2007 and October 2007.Standard isolation and identification technique of bacteria was adopted.MAIN OUTCOME MEASURES:Concentration of bacteria and prevalence of three species of bacteria in water effluent from the air-water syringe and the high-speed handpiece line of DCUs at each flushing volume were evaluated.RESULTS:The median concentration of bacteria in water effluent from either the air-water syringe or the high-speed handpiece line of DCUs was 5.67×10~2 cfu/mL,and there were no statistical differences among microbial concentrations of first three 2-mL flushing water samples (P>0.05).Prevalence of Staphylococcus spp.from the third 2-mL flushing water sample demonstrated an obviously higher level than that of Staphylococcus spp.from the first two 2-mL (P < 0.05),while prevalence of Streptococcus spp.and Actinomycete spp.kept at a relative stable level (P > 0.05) at each flushing volume.CONCLUSION:Volume-dependent water flushing procedure stays a more practical measure for reducing microbial contamination in DUWLs rather than time-dependent flushing,but the volume of flushing water needs to be further evaluated.
